Overview

A DC control panel is a crucial component in systems that rely on direct current (DC) power. It serves as the central hub for power distribution, monitoring, and protection, ensuring efficient and safe operation of DC-powered equipment. Commonly used in industries such as renewable energy, telecommunications, and data centers, these panels are designed to handle various voltage and current requirements. The panels are typically modular, allowing for customization based on specific application needs. They integrate components like circuit breakers, fuses, voltage regulators, and monitoring devices to provide comprehensive control over the DC power system. Advanced models may also include remote monitoring and automation features for enhanced operational efficiency.

Structure and Working Principle

A standard DC control panel consists of a robust enclosure, usually made of steel or aluminum, to protect internal components from environmental factors. Inside, the panel houses busbars, circuit breakers, fuses, and other protective devices. These components work together to distribute power from the DC source to various loads while preventing overloads and short circuits. The working principle revolves around regulating and distributing DC power efficiently. Input power is received from a DC source, such as a battery bank or rectifier, and is then distributed to connected loads via busbars. Protective devices monitor the system for faults and isolate problematic circuits to prevent damage. Modern panels may also include digital displays or remote communication interfaces for real-time monitoring and control.

Key Features

DC control panels are designed with several key features to ensure reliability and safety. These include overload protection, which prevents damage from excessive current, and voltage regulation to maintain stable power output. Many panels also feature modular designs, allowing for easy expansion or reconfiguration as system requirements change. Additional features may include remote monitoring capabilities, enabling operators to track performance and diagnose issues from a distance. Some panels are equipped with energy metering functions to measure power consumption and optimize efficiency. High-quality panels are built to withstand harsh environments, with corrosion-resistant materials and robust construction.

Application Areas

DC control panels are widely used in industries that rely on DC power systems. In renewable energy applications, such as solar and wind farms, they manage power distribution from photovoltaic arrays or wind turbines to storage batteries and inverters. Telecommunications infrastructure also heavily depends on these panels to ensure uninterrupted power supply for critical equipment. Data centers use DC control panels to distribute power to servers and networking devices, often in conjunction with uninterruptible power supplies (UPS). Other applications include industrial automation, transportation systems, and marine vessels, where reliable DC power is essential for operation.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ity and reliability of a DC control panel. This includes inspecting connections for signs of wear or corrosion, tightening loose terminals, and testing protective devices like circuit breakers and fuses. Cleaning the panel interior to remove dust and debris is also recommended. Precautions include ensuring proper grounding to prevent electrical shocks and avoiding overloading the panel beyond its rated capacity.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ines for maintenance and operation. In case of any faults or unusual behavior, shut down the system and consult a qualified technician to avoid further damage.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ring a DC control panel for business use, consider factors such as current and voltage requirements, environmental conditions, and certification standards. Panels should comply with relevant industry standards, such as IEC or UL, to ensure safety and reliability. It's also important to evaluate the supplier's reputation, lead times, and after-sales support. Customization options may be available to meet specific application needs, so discuss requirements with the manufacturer. For reference, prices typically range from $500 to $5,000, depending on size and features. Always request detailed specifications and warranty information before making a purchase.
